               		§ 49-4-52 - Eligibility for assistance under this article
               		
               		
               	 	
               	 	               	 	
               	 	
               	 	
               	 		
O.C.G.A.    49-4-52   (2010)
   49-4-52.    Eligibility for assistance under this article 
      (a)  Assistance shall be granted under this article to any blind person who:
      (1)  Does  not have sufficient income or other resources to provide a reasonable  subsistence compatible with decency and health, except that, after March  1, 1961, in making such determination, the first $85.00 per month of  earned income plus one-half of earned income in excess of $85.00 per  month shall be disregarded;
      (2)  Has been a bona fide resident of the state for not less than one year;
      (3)  Is not receiving old-age assistance; and
      (4)  Is  not publicly soliciting alms in any part of this state by the wearing,  carrying, or exhibiting of signs denoting blindness, by the carrying of  receptacles for the reception of alms, by the doing of such acts by  proxy, or by begging from house to house.
(b)  All  assistance under this article shall be suspended in the event of and  during the period of confinement in any public penal institution after  final conviction of a crime against the laws of this state or any  political subdivision thereof.
